About this study

Malnutrition is a frequent complication of cirrhosis, and it has been associated with a more severe disease and decompensating events. Despite its relevance, there is no gold standard for nutritional assessment in cirrhosis, and intrinsic pathophysiologic changes make biochemical markers and traditional methods used to evaluate malnutrition unreliable. Phase angle (PhA) obtained from bioelectrical impedance has been successfully used as a nutritional marker in several diseases such as chronic renal failure, cancer, and HIV, where it has been associated with prolonged in-hospital stay and mortality. In cirrhosis, research linking malnutrition to increased mortality has yielded conflicting results, likely due to the lack of a gold standard. A few PhA cut-off points have been proposed to define malnutrition in cirrhosis, and they have proven to be useful in prognosticating severity of the disease and mortality. However, PhA needs specific validation in different ethnic groups. The aim of this study was to evaluate the PhA cut-off value that would best define malnutrition and predict mortality in patients with liver cirrhosis.
